Transaction 784da920b736ed0294803c54ed4ab56d9b2fbdbab76f17f07fc83135da010f93

1 Input
2 Outputs
  • 784da920b736ed0294803c54ed4ab56d9b2fbdbab76f17f07fc83135da010f93:0
  • value  627374
    address  3FFEj1wYLa6pd7uuwVZjrD8Wh32NdNrs4b
  • 784da920b736ed0294803c54ed4ab56d9b2fbdbab76f17f07fc83135da010f93:1
  • value  1000000
    address  33jHiGPaapcfk2E61yacEdLmhZJHndAohr